What Is ZEST Eyelid Therapy?

 

ZEST stands for Zocular Eyelid System Treatment. It is an in-office eyelid therapy designed for patients with dry eye, blepharitis, and eyelid inflammation. The treatment uses a natural, okra-based formulation to gently cleanse the eyelids and lashes.
 

The eyelids play an important role in eye comfort. Healthy eyelids help spread the tear film evenly across the eyes with every blink. When bacteria, oil, debris, or crusting collect along the lash line, the eyes can become irritated and the tear film can become unstable. ZEST helps address this buildup at the source.
 

Why Eyelid Health Matters For Chronic Dry Eyes

 

Many cases of chronic dry eyes are connected to meibomian gland dysfunction, also known as MGD. These glands sit along the eyelids and release oils that help prevent tears from evaporating too quickly. When the glands become blocked or inflamed, the tear film may break down faster, leading to dryness, burning, fluctuating vision, and irritation.
 

For Waterloo patients, dry eye triggers can also include seasonal allergies, winter dryness, long hours on digital devices, contact lens wear, and certain medications. Because dry eye has many possible causes, a professional evaluation is important before choosing the right treatment.
 

How ZEST Works

 

During ZEST eyelid therapy, the provider gently applies the cleansing solution along the eyelid margins and lashes. The goal is to remove debris, oil residue, bacteria, and other buildup that can contribute to dry eye symptoms and blepharitis.
 

ZEST is often described as a deep cleaning for the eyelids. It is more thorough than at-home lid wipes because it is performed in office by an eye care professional. After the treatment, patients may receive guidance on at-home eyelid care to help maintain results.
 

Signs You May Benefit From ZEST

 

ZEST may be recommended for patients whose dry eye symptoms are tied to eyelid inflammation or poor eyelid hygiene. Common signs include:
 

  • Burning, stinging, or gritty eyes
  • Redness or irritation around the eyelids
  • Crusting near the lashes
  • Watery eyes that still feel dry
  • Fluctuating or blurry vision
  • Contact lens discomfort
  • Symptoms that return after using artificial tears
